Bike & Balance

Balance and Bike is a 4-week pediatric PT class for children ages 7 and older who are developmentally appropriate for training wheels and motivated to learn two-wheel riding.

The class focuses on improving balance, core control, and bike-riding skills through activities that mimic weight shifting and steering. Therapeutic balls, incline/decline surfaces, and rhythmic movements are used to provide progressively challenging balance activities while encouraging postural reactions and coordination. Parents will be given instruction on how to assist their child in mastering the skill of independently riding a bike and strategies to continue practicing safely at home. Parents should plan on bringing comfortable shoes and be ready to run.

Children bring their own bikes with training wheels. Sessions include mounting, dismounting, walking alongside the bike, turning, braking, and safe falling practice on soft mats. Proper bike fit is emphasized, with the child able to sit on the bike with both feet flat on the floor to improve confidence and reduce fear. Training wheels are gradually raised and eventually removed as skills improve!
